You are reading "25 Best Gulf Coast Beaches … Web30 de mar. de 2024 · St. George Island is one of the most secluded beaches in Florida, nestled on a 22 mile barrier island off the “Forgotten Coast” in the northwest corner of the state. The uncrowded beaches are perfect for swimming or just relaxing on the sugary sand. Fishing and kayaking in the clear Gulf waters are popular pastimes as well.

Web4 de nov. de 2024 · A 28-mile-long barrier island on the northern Gulf Coast, this pristine isle is protected, which means it's fantastically clean and lush. You won't find high-rises marring the beautiful landscape, but you will run into some of the best beaches in Florida. St. George Island State Park is home to one of the loveliest beaches on the island.

Wander around Dock and Second streets, with its galleries ... how to remove gray line in wordWeb19 de mai. de 2010 · It is not unusual to find tar balls in Keys waters or on area beaches. The Keys are located along a busy commercial shipping route, with some 8,000 vessels passing by annually, and commercial vessels sometimes discharge bilge water that contains oil.
